Celebrating the nation's food
BBC Commisions new cookery series
.
THE BBC has commissioned Optomen TV to produce a new cookery series celebrating the nation's food.
Fourteen of Britain's top chefs are to scoure the country for the very best regional produce to create the perfect four-course menu. The ?nal dishes will be chosen by a public vote and the meal will be served at a special lunch to be held at Mansion House on June 15 marking Her Majesty the Queen's 80th birthday.
Lord Mayor, David Brewer, who will host the lunch, said: "The City of London is proud to honour Her Majesty, on behalf of the nation, on this very special occasion. Food brings us all together - and through this event the whole country can take part." Jay Hunt, Controller of BBC Daytime, said: "British food has never been so exciting. This ambitious new series from BBC Daytime is a de?nitive, nationwide search for the best ingredients to be transformed into innovative dishes by some of the country's top chefs."
The programme starts on April 10, on BBC Two at 6.30pm.
